BLACKPINK Jisoo recently revealed an intriguing connection with 'When The Phone Rings' Kdrama actress Chae Soo-bin. During a conversation, Jisoo shared that she and Chae Soo-bin were classmates in middle school. Reflecting on their shared past, she said, “I talked about it because I was in the same class as actress Chae Soo-bin. We went to middle school together, not high school.” This revelation highlights the bond between the two stars, who are now carving successful paths in their respective fields.

Interestingly, Jisoo and Chae Soo-bin are set to reunite professionally as co-stars in the highly anticipated movie Omniscient Reader’s Viewpoint. The film, which boasts a stellar cast including Ahn Hyo Seop and Lee Min Ho, is scheduled for release in 2025. Fans are eager to witness the on-screen chemistry between these two talented actresses, given their long-standing connection.

While the movie is generating buzz, Jisoo is also focused on her ongoing acting projects. The BLACKPINK member is currently working on another Kdrama, Monthly Boyfriend, set to release in 2025, showcasing her versatility as an artist.
